Nehmen Sie den Wert neben dem letzten in xslt

<Address>
1234Road
Unit 5 Lane
Town, City
SO1D 23Z
Customer No. 12321312312
</Address>

<Address>
21321311234Road
1234Road
Unit 5 Lane
Town, City
SO1D 23Z
Customer No. 12321312312
</Address>

Kann mir jemand helfen, immer den Wert der Postleitzahl zu ermitteln, der immer vor der Kundennummer steh

<xsl:value-of select="substring-before(substring-after(substring-after(substring-after(Address,'&#10;'),'&#10;'),'&#10;'),'&#10;')"/>

Ich habe das oben Genannte verwendet, werde aber das zweite Beispiel nicht bearbeiten. Müssen Sie einen Weg finden, um neben dem letzten zu nehmen.

Hinweis: Zwischen jeder Zeile befinden sich Zeilenumbrüche (CRLF).

Jede Hilfe wird sehr geschätzt

Antworten auf die Frage(4)

Ihre Antwort auf die Frage